Analysis

In 2024, beans, dry — gross production value in Madagascar stood at 64,142 1000 Int$.

The figure is down 7.7% on the previous year and down 3.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, beans, dry — gross production value in Madagascar peaked at 69,484 1000 Int$ in 2023 and was at its lowest, 30,924 1000 Int$, in 1981.

Madagascar ranks 40th of 127 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 64 years of available data.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 37,966 1000 Int$ 32,776 1000 Int$ 43,333 1000 Int$ 9
1970s 42,354 1000 Int$ 34,103 1000 Int$ 47,621 1000 Int$ 10
1980s 33,630 1000 Int$ 30,924 1000 Int$ 36,595 1000 Int$ 10
1990s 56,040 1000 Int$ 33,508 1000 Int$ 62,504 1000 Int$ 10
2000s 58,264 1000 Int$ 53,357 1000 Int$ 62,594 1000 Int$ 10
2010s 63,301 1000 Int$ 48,021 1000 Int$ 67,028 1000 Int$ 10
2020s 62,984 1000 Int$ 52,595 1000 Int$ 69,484 1000 Int$ 5

The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
